Devs Behind Cute Pet Sim Game Are ‘Worried” About Being Buried

Playing the fast-paced retro-inspired FPS game Selaco, I round a corner and take down three space guards with a grenade launcher, watching their body parts fly through the air. Meanwhile, Mustard, my digital pet from the game Weyrdlets, hangs out on my desktop as I work and play games on my PC. After defeating some guards in Selaco, I always make sure to pet Mustard before jumping back into the action.

Mustard, a cute pink lizard-like creature that I named, is a delightful companion. Intrigued by his creation, I decided to learn more about the indie game industry in 2024 and spoke with Weyrdworks, the developers behind Weyrdlets, to understand the game’s concept and how they navigate the competitive world of new game releases on platforms like Steam.

According to game director Shawn Beck, Weyrdlets is a cozy virtual pet game that revolves around a community of colorful characters. Unlike traditional games with objectives, this game focuses on caring for a pet in a friendly environment, serving as a desktop companion and an idle game.

Taking inspiration from games like Animal Crossing, the art director JT Yean describes Weyrdlets as a game that aims to blend into the background while you go about your daily tasks on your PC. Wing Yee, the social media specialist, likens it to a modern version of Microsoft Clippy.

One of the unique features of Weyrdlets is the ability to let your pet roam freely on your desktop while you work or play other games. The game’s transparent background allows the virtual pet to interact with your desktop without hindering your activities.

Despite the competitive landscape of the gaming industry, the team at Weyrdworks remains focused on delivering value to their players. They acknowledge the challenges of standing out among the numerous game releases on platforms like Steam but believe that the niche appeal of virtual pet games will set them apart.

For aspiring developers, the team advises sharing your work and seeking feedback from players to improve the game. They emphasize the importance of community involvement and plan to continue updating Weyrdlets with new features and content post-launch.

Excited for the future, Weyrdworks has ambitious plans for Weyrdlets, including a soccer mode and ongoing updates to keep players engaged. The game is set to launch on July 23, promising an ever-evolving experience for virtual pet enthusiasts.

A Mac version of the game will be released post-launch

You can now access a free demo of the game on Steam while waiting for the Mac version to become available.
